What's up, everyone? Welcome back to The Level Up Podcast. I'm Paul Alex, and today we are talking about a leadership flaw that creates total operational paralysis, the cost of indecision. Because let's be real. If you have a massive strategic problem sitting on your desk, and you refuse to make a call because you are terrified of getting it wrong, you are actively driving the ship into an iceberg. Let's break down why a bad choice is always better than no choice. First, understand that time kills all deals, but hesitation kills the entire company. Too many founders want perfect data before they make a move. In the real world, perfect data does not exist. If you stall a massive product launch for six months trying to make it flawless, your competitor will launch an imperfect version and steal the entire market. Whether you are dealing with a bad vendor or deciding to pivot your core offer, sitting in the middle of the road will get you run over. If you refuse to choose, you kill your agility.
Second, you have to realize that a wrong decision provides immediate, actionable data. People do not scale massive businesses by never making mistakes. They scale by making a fast decision, realizing it was the wrong one, and instantly course correcting based on real world feedback. So instead of staring at a spreadsheet for another week, pull the trigger today.
Make aggressive, decisive action your ultimate standard operating procedure. Lastly, decisive leadership creates an incredibly confident team. When your operators know that the CEO will step up, absorb the risk, and make the hard call instantly, their anxiety completely vanishes. Elite confidence, rapid iteration, and a refusal to be paralyzed create an unstoppable founder. When you cure your indecision, you unlock massive speed. Bottom line, you cannot steer a parked car.
